BASKETBALL: Hoopers crush newcomers Ondo Raiders in blow out win

Image
Rivers Hoopers shook off a slow start to demolish new comers Ondo Raiders 85-28 in the ongoing NBBF Premier League tagged “President Cup” at the Indoor Sports Hall of the Kwara Stadium, Ilorin on Monday. Ikechuku Benjamin led the way with 16 points, one rebound, one assist and one steal including three pointers and 3/4 from the free throw line in 18 minutes. Solomon Ajegbeyi added 14 points, eight rebounds, two assists, one steal and one block. Ajegbeyi also shot a rare three pointer late in the game as he was cheered by his teammates on the bench. Other Hoopers' players on double digit: Ronald Alalibo had 12 points, five rebounds, two steals and one assist. He also shot 4/8 from the deep while Abdul Yahaya added 10 points, four rebounds, one assist and one steal. Rivers Hoopers were scoreless in the first three minutes of the game. BASKETBALL: Hoopers Face Tough Test As Third Round Of League Games Resumes

Image
Rivers Hoopers head coach Ogoh Odaudu admitted his wards face a stern test as the third round of the 2017 Kwese Premier Basketball League gets underway on Thursday. Hoopers will face Nigeria Customs in Lagos in their opening 3rd round game on Thursday. Last season’s finalist inflicted defeat on the KingsMen in the league opener in Lagos (60-49) but the Port Harcourt club got their pound of flesh when the two sides met in Port Harcourt on May 18. Speaking in a tone not unexpected of him, Odaudu affirmed yet again that Customs will not be underestimated.              “It’s going to be a real test for us because we are playing away from home and like you know, Customs are not an easy team even though we blew them out here (Port Harcourt) 78-50. BASKETBALL: HOOPERS LOSE LEAGUE OPENER TO CUSTOMS

Image
    Rivers Hoopers were outrebounded and outshot from three point range losing to Nigeria Customs 60-49 at the Indoor Sports Hall, National Stadium Lagos on Thursday.   Despite falling to Customs, former Customs power forward, Solomon Ajegbeyi scored 10 points, 8 rebounds and 2 assists delivering consecutive baskets in the first but not enough to salvage the loss to Customs.   Ikechukwu Benjamin’s jumper before the buzzer ended the first quarter (15-19). The Port Harcourt side produced a brilliant first half performance looking ready to go for the kill in the second half but was brilliantly guarded by the Customs defense in the third quarter.   Customs guard, Okiki Afuwapa Michael who was their best player finished with a game high 25 points, 7 rebounds and 3 assists.   Okiki’s shooting pushed Customs to the lead and in over 4 minutes of play, Hoopers couldn’t score leaving the host to  their biggest score run(9-0)  in 6:22. BASKETBALL: Rivers Hoopers gear up for new season with experienced singings

Image
  Rivers Hoopers basketball club of Port Harcourt has intensified their preparations for the upcoming 2016/2017 Nigeria Basketball League season by making key additions to their playing staff.   The former champions who made a quick return to top flight last season after missing out of the 2014/2015 season will head into the new season after finishing third on their return last term.   The Port Harcourt based Hoopers retained 10 players out of the 14 that featured for them last season and added 5 new players to the fold, with Lagos Warriors guard, Anyebe Ujoh prominent among them.   Ujoh makes a return to the team he won the League double with in the 2010/2011 and 2011/2012 season. He however left for Kano Pillars the following year winning two straight titles in 2012/2013 and 2013/2014 season.
